    What's special

    High-Floor 2BR Condo with Endless Views Lose yourself in luxury and enjoy some of the best views in the city from walls of immense picture windows wrapped around this stunning Upper West Side apartment, perched high on the 24th floor! Residence 24A, superbly located close to Central Park, sits in a premier full-service condominium and has just undergone an impeccable gut-renovation, making it an extremely rare and coveted offering. Whether for use as your primary home or a wonderful pied-a-terre, life at The Park Belvedere is incomparable with its array of white-glove amenities. This light-bathed corner split 2-bedroom, 2-bathroom jewel with airy 9' ceilings will awe you the moment you arrive, with 270 degrees of incredible views at every turn. These include direct Central Park and Museum of Natural History panoramas to the east, stretching open city, park and Midtown skyline vistas to the south, and river views to the west. Current owners have done an outstanding job recreating the expansive 1,330 square feet of living space, opening up the kitchen and adding a huge island, installing beautiful natural white oak wood flooring that pours throughout, incorporating top-grade fit and finish in kitchen and baths, and assuring a pin-drop-quiet ambience with all brand new Citi-Quiet windows. Entertain casually or lavishly in the gorgeous open living/dining room brightened by corner exposures, showcasing timeless views galore. A finely appointed renovated chef's kitchen lets the sun shine in and affords all the bells and whistles, with sleek new custom cabinetry and pantry, new Caesarstone countertops and a premium LG appliance package. The gracious entry foyer leads to the generous primary suite tucked on the east side of the home, and the spacious second bedroom suite situated in the southwest corner. From your divine primary retreat you'll indulge in fabulous park views extending all the way to the reservoir, along with a custom walk-in closet and upscale spa bath with soaking tub/shower. The skyline views seem endless in bedroom 2 as well, featuring a wall of closets, an adjoining hall with a closet, lovely full bath, and in-home GE washer-dryer. The magnificent Park Belvedere, built in 1984, stands 34 stories at the prime corner of Columbus Avenue and 79th Street, across from The Museum of Natural History and moments from Central Park. The handsome condominium building offers 24-hour doorman and concierge service, a laundry facility, bike storage and a common roof deck, as well as an intimate feel with small elevator landings and only a handful of homes per floor. The outstanding address is in the heart of the city's most coveted residential neighborhood near the park, culture, markets, gyms, shopping, dining, and subway transportation.
